Strong and healthy as an ox…

I cannot affirm or deny that statement; I’ve never studied the health condition of oxen. I do know that there are lots of sick folks. I wish them well; I pray.

“Beloved, I pray that in all respects you may prosper and be in good health, just as your soul prospers (3 John 2 NASB).”

Good health is a blessing; we often take it for granted.

Seeking healing, many grasp at straws.

In faith, one woman touched the fringe of Jesus’ garment.

“And a woman who had been suffering from a hemorrhage for twelve years, came up behind Him and touched the fringe of His cloak;  for she was saying to herself, ‘If I only touch His garment, I will get well.’  But Jesus turning and seeing her said, ‘Daughter, take courage; your faith has made you well.’ At once the woman was made well (Matthew 9:20-22 NASB).”

I wish people well; I pray. On occasion, I send get well greeting cards. Jesus, seeing faith in the infirmed has the power to ‘make them well.’
